I went to the Amsterdamse Bos today. It’s a short way from my house, and depending on how I vary my route it takes me 3 to 4 hours to walk around it.
The place was crowded with people walking their dogs or their kids. “Bos” (forest) is perhaps a bit of a misnomer. The Amsterdamse Bos is more of a very large city park. “Amsterdamse” is perhaps also not quite right; legally, the area falls under the municipality of Amstelveen.
